    Came here to catch the Texans game with some friends. It's located in the downtown area of Dallas. I knew there was valet beforehand but for whatever reason I parked at the Tom Thumb nearby which offered complimentary parking (for two hours I believe?) if you buy something. That was certainly not enough time. In retrospect, I should have used the valet - after reading the reviews here, apparently they have great service and are very reliable. Since it was a gameday, it was definitely packed inside. We were quickly seated though. Quickly, in terms of service, our waiter was great. It was clear he was putting in effort and being nice to all of his tables. The issue, however, was that he was severely stretched thin. I remember looking around for him and I swear I saw him taking care of customers on the other side of the restaurant. For food, I got a house salad to start. I decided to be healthy today. Unfortunately, a salad at a sports-focused establishment may not have been the best idea. The majority of the lettuce was wilted and not fresh. The dressing provided some nice tang but couldn't offset the texture of the veggies. The chilaquiles on the brunch menu, on the other hand, were good. The chips were still a bit crunchy and was the perfect bed for all of the toppings. I definitely recommend it. Overall, I probably won't come back on my own volition - only if for a group event - due to the lack of staff that caused service and some of the food quality.

    My youngest son and I were going to a Dallas Mavericks game at American Airlines Center and wanted something to eat prior to the game. We arrived around 540 on a Saturday night and were able to get a seat immediately. I was happy to get a table (since my son is a minor) and there were some groups dressed very well and us in NBA gear for the game. Our waiter was friendly and attentive. I had a Shiner Draft and the Blackened Chicken Pasta. My youngest son had a cheesesteak. Both of our meals came out very quickly and were very tasty. Yes, the environment is very loud but between being a great place to watch a sporting event, close to the American Airlines Center, the rooftop has to be epic. I'd definitely return!

    Is this place 21+?

    Only for the upstairs 21+ lounge on the weekends. There is a bouncer at the stairs that checks ID's. The downstairs and outdoor patio is for everyone though.

    Is there a happy hour and if so, when is it?

    Yes! Happy Hour is Monday - Thursday from 4 PM - 7 PM
